Association Arubaanse Voetbal Bond Confederation CONCACAF FIFA code ARU FIFA ranking Unranked Highest FIFA ranking 92 (December 2009) Lowest FIFA ranking 144 (December 2007) Home coloursAway coloursThe Aruba women's national football team is the national women's football team of Aruba and is overseen by the Arubaanse Voetbal Bond.
